What can I do in Rimini?
Travelers enjoy exploring the beaches, as well as visiting the historic sites and other landmarks. Check out the interesting exhibits at The Surgeon’s House and Rimini City Museum, or head to Viale Vespucci or Viale Regina Elena for some retail therapy. A few other attractions you may want to see are Piazza Cavour and Castel Sismondo.
What's the weather like in Rimini?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 74°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 47°F. Average annual precipitation for Rimini is 31 inches.
What's the best way to get to and around Rimini?
Fly into Federico Fellini Intl. Airport (RMI), which is located 3.7 mi (6 km) away from the heart of the city. If you’d like to explore more of the area, ride aboard a train from Rimini Station, RiminiFiera Station, or Rimini-Viserba Station.
